Transaction 43dff31e3dd59c0d996a71e4d27ee3d4736dc71eaeea745928f5392ac160bc84

2 Input
2 Outputs
  • 43dff31e3dd59c0d996a71e4d27ee3d4736dc71eaeea745928f5392ac160bc84:0
  • value  6828305
    address  1PcrSmBPd4YwLHmG61wPGRRQAHRUrXkDt
  • 43dff31e3dd59c0d996a71e4d27ee3d4736dc71eaeea745928f5392ac160bc84:1
  • value  73086500
    address  188E6zGm4uBnMra9hgCdzwsHAEu8Xbt23L